Manufacturing Processes of James Harden Basketball Shoes
The production of James Harden basketball shoes involves a series of meticulously planned and executed stages, ensuring both performance and durability meet international standards. For B2B buyers, understanding these stages aids in assessing supplier capabilities and maintaining quality consistency across orders.
Material Preparation
The process begins with sourcing high-quality raw materials tailored for athletic footwear. Key materials include:
- Uppers: Typically constructed from engineered mesh, synthetic leather, or knit fabrics that balance breathability and support.
- Midsole: Often utilizing EVA foam, polyurethane, or proprietary cushioning compounds like Adidas Boost, designed to absorb shock and enhance energy return.
- Outsole: Usually made from durable rubber compounds with specialized tread patterns for grip and traction.
Suppliers often pre-treat materials to improve adhesion and longevity, adhering to international standards such as ISO 9001 for quality management.
Forming and Molding
Once materials are prepared, they are shaped through advanced molding techniques:
- Injection Molding: Used for components like midsoles and outsoles, allowing precise control over shape and density.
- Heat Molding & Lamination: Applied to attach uppers to soles, ensuring a secure bond with minimal defects.
- 3D Printing: Emerging for prototyping or complex component production, offering rapid iteration and customization.
These processes are performed in controlled environments to prevent contamination and defects, with strict adherence to manufacturing protocols.
Assembly
The assembly phase integrates all components into a finished shoe:
- Stitching & Bonding: High-frequency or ultrasonic welding techniques are employed for seamless bonding of uppers and linings.
- Inserting Cushioning & Support Elements: Such as insoles, shanks, or heel counters, tailored for performance demands.
- Quality of Fit & Finish: Automated and manual inspections ensure the alignment of components, consistency of stitching, and absence of surface defects.
Automated assembly lines with robotics are common for consistency, complemented by skilled labor for quality checks.
Finishing and Packaging
Final steps include:
- Surface Treatment: Applying coatings for water resistance or aesthetic enhancements.
- Labeling & Branding: Embossing or printing logos and size information.
- Packaging: Using eco-friendly, durable packaging materials suitable for international shipping.
Throughout these stages, suppliers maintain detailed documentation aligned with ISO standards, facilitating traceability and accountability.

Cost Structure Breakdown for James Harden Basketball Shoes
Understanding the comprehensive cost structure is essential for international B2B buyers aiming to optimize procurement. The primary cost components include:
- Materials: The choice of synthetic leather, mesh, rubber, and specialized foams significantly influences costs. High-performance or customized materials can elevate prices but may offer competitive advantages in quality and branding.
- Labor: Manufacturing labor costs vary widely depending on the sourcing country. Countries like China or Vietnam typically offer lower wages, whereas Eastern European or Middle Eastern manufacturers may have higher labor costs but can provide better quality control or shorter lead times.
- Manufacturing Overheads: These include machine maintenance, factory utilities, and administrative expenses. Efficient factories with high-capacity utilization tend to keep overhead costs lower, impacting the unit price.
- Tooling and Molding: Initial tooling costs are substantial but amortized over large production runs. For small orders or customized designs, tooling costs can significantly increase unit prices.
- Quality Control (QC): Rigorous QC processes, especially for certifications like ISO or safety standards, add to costs but are crucial for ensuring product consistency and compliance, especially for markets with strict import regulations.
- Logistics & Shipping: Freight costs depend on volume, destination, and mode of transportation. Air freight offers speed but at a premium, while sea freight is cost-effective for bulk shipments. Incoterms like FOB or CIF influence who bears shipping costs and risks.
- Profit Margin: Suppliers typically aim for a margin of 15-30%, but this varies based on order volume, relationship, and market competitiveness.

Essential Industry and Trade Terms
1.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er)
Refers to factories that produce shoes branded under different labels. B2B buyers often source OEM products for private labeling or custom branding. Understanding OEM capabilities ensures quality standards are met while facilitating branding strategies.
2. M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ity)
The smallest quantity of shoes a manufacturer agrees to produce per order. MOQs impact procurement costs and inventory planning, especially for smaller markets or regional distributors. Negotiating flexible MOQs can help new entrants test markets with lower investment.
3. RFQ (Request for Quotation)
A formal process where buyers solicit detailed price and delivery terms from suppliers. Efficient RFQ responses enable comparative analysis of costs, lead times, and quality assurances, facilitating informed purchasing decisions.
4. Incoterms (International Commercial Terms)
Standardized trade terms defining responsibilities for shipping, insurance, and customs clearance. Common Incoterms like FOB (Free on Board) or C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ight) clarify cost-sharing and risk transfer points, essential for international logistics planning.
5. Certification and Compliance Terms
Labels such as ISO, CE, or REACH indicate adherence to international safety and environmental standards. Ensuring suppliers provide valid certifications minimizes legal risks and enhances product acceptance in diverse markets.
6. Lead Time
The duration from order placement to product delivery. Shorter lead times improve supply chain flexibility, especially in dynamic markets. B2B buyers should verify supplier capacity and historical delivery performance to align with market demands.

What are typical MOQs, lead times, and payment terms for importing James Harden shoes?
MOQs for basketball shoes typically range from 500 to 5,000 pairs, influenced by the supplier and customization level. Lead times vary from 30 to 90 days after order confirmation, depending on production complexity and shipping logistics. Common payment terms include 30% upfront deposit with the balance payable before shipment, or letters of credit for larger orders. Establishing clear payment terms, possibly leveraging escrow services or trade finance options, can mitigate risks and improve cash flow management in international transactions. -
